Why Paver and Artificial Grass Works So Well Together

Here’s the deal: artificial grass gives you a lush, green look without the stress. No mowing. No watering. No worrying about whether it’s too sunny or not sunny enough. It’s just… green. Always.

Now, mix in some pavers and suddenly your yard looks like it was designed by a pro. The pavers give structure and flow—walkways, lounging areas, accents around fire pits or flower beds. And the artificial grass softens the look, adds contrast, and keeps things feeling fresh and natural (without the actual nature drama).

Together? They create a yard that’s stylish, sturdy, and basically maintenance-free.

Save Time, Money, and Sanity

Let’s be honest—traditional landscaping is expensive. And not just upfront.

You’ve got water bills, fertilizer, lawn service, and constant upkeep. Plus, the time. Who actually wants to spend every Saturday trimming, raking, and fixing whatever the weather messed up this week?

When you go with paver and artificial grass, you eliminate most of that. The upfront investment pays off quickly when you realize you’re no longer buying seed or calling someone to “check the sprinklers again.”

Your weekends are suddenly open. Your water bill’s way lower. And your yard still looks freshly done—without lifting a finger.
